But now, many years later, he's thriving, and it looks like Bandai Namco is teaming up with animation studio Cartuna Production to bring a short animated series to YouTube featuring the one and only yellow ball himself in a series titled PAC-MAN: Snack Breaks.
Cartuna Productions has worked on many well-known franchises such as SpongeBob and Goofy, while also having a history of doing animation for celebrities such as Justin Bieber and Doja Cat.
Their style looks fun, colourful, bouncy and well polished, perfect for showing PAC-MAN's new adventure, in a new animated world that will release in episodes once a month on May 22nd on the official PAC-MAN YouTube channel.
The teaser trailer itselfs shows PAC-MAN leaving his home town with nothing but snacks, heading towards a large, colorful and bright city where he'll undoubtedly get in trouble and will come across his pesky enemies in a unique and hopefully, visually exciting manner.

It's directed by Noah Pardo, produced by Adam Belfer and James Belfer alongside the great writing by Garrett Beltis.
